Transaction 419196aacf1ef9592a5a2836f9ec8bb69c824e112f327f71a65f6bc4f87dd786
1 Input
1 Output
-
419196aacf1ef9592a5a2836f9ec8bb69c824e112f327f71a65f6bc4f87dd786:0
- value
- 39840000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375aa7c7f9cf82fd68060e41499ec05c2eabf OP_EQUAL
- address
- 3BMEXZJdLmT72Bfy61Qx7erFaqN3iSrqYG